Join AWP Safety as a Traffic Control Flagger, where you will be an essential part of our team, ensuring safety at job sites. No prior experience or degree is required; we are dedicated to your training and career development. Your safety is our top priority.
In this role, your daily responsibilities will include:
Setting up and dismantling cones, signs, and barricades for effective traffic control.
Utilizing a stop/slow paddle to direct traffic and monitor job site activities.
Adhering to all safety protocols as taught during training.
Communicating effectively with crew members and supervisors.
Maintaining cleanliness and safety of vehicles and equipment.
Working outdoors in varying weather conditions throughout the year.
Flexibility is key as shifts may include nights, weekends, or emergency work as needed.
Be prepared to stand or walk for 8 to 12 hours during your shifts.
We provide a hard hat, safety goggles, vest, whistle, walkie-talkie, and weather gear; you will need to bring your own steel-toe boots.
